Will Internet Business Taxes Do Away With Affiliate Programs?

Copyright: Earl Williams
The NetMarketer

The continued discussion about Internet business taxes has many a small time online entrepreneur wondering if this fiscal step will do away with affiliate programs. Thus far many an online entrepreneur has looked to affiliate programs as a great way of making easy money online. In simplest terms, such programs encourage independent online marketers to put their skills to work to promote a third party and then entice consumers to purchase goods and services through the affiliate link in exchange for a percentage of the profit the company realizes by virtue of the business transaction the affiliate marketer inspired.

Should Internet business taxes be instituted in such business relationships, the days for affiliate programs might be numbered. Considering that the average transaction is measured in pennies, it is going to be the duty of the affiliate marketer to take a direct hit against the sum total of all earnings made, and unlike the company offering the affiliate membership it is the marketer who needs to make the tax payments. Even as during the year this might not present an immediately recognizable problem to the individual, it is during tax season that such Internet business taxes will lead to the realization that the time and effort spent at growing the business are not as rewarding as it appeared throughout the preceding 12 months.

Businesses offering affiliate programs are unlikely to offer incentives to offset their affiliate entrepreneurs tax liabilities. This of course is due to the fact that for each online entrepreneur the tax will be different, depending on the size of the operation and also the amounts of income generated with the help of affiliate links. With no help from other businesses, the entrepreneur has to think long and hard whether to continue engaging in an activity that leads to a delayed tax obligations or if it might be worthwhile to shift the focus of online entrepreneurial work to more immediately lucrative ventures.

To this end, Internet business taxes might quite possible hail the end of affiliate marketing programs such as they are known today. Granted, some consumers will not miss the more garish means of advertisements namely pop up ads or flashing banners but others understand that a failure to reward online affiliates also leads to a great reduction in the various deals available. You see, quite a few of online affiliates look to price reduction as a premier means of getting consumers to take their business to one company versus another.

The added savings are not only enticing, but also lead to several deal wars that make online purchases such a promising endeavor in an effort to save money. With an advent of Internet business taxes these price wars may be coming to an end and suddenly the online market place may not be so lucrative any longer. In the long run, the loss of affiliate business is going to directly impact the number of online merchants offering choices to consumers searching for good deals. Brick and mortar businesses that are relying on the Internet to bolster their incomes are going to find a great reduction in income.

Slow or Fast Ways on How to Get Rich

Publisher: Earl Williams
The NetMarketer

Many people want to know how to get rich and often times, they want virtually instant gratification. Unfortunately, accumulating wealth takes time and effort as well as sacrifice and risk. The Warren Buffets and Bill Gates' of the world did not make their fortunes in a day but rather it took years of hard work and risk to pull it off.

Fast Way to Get Rich

If you want to know how to get rich fast, you must be prepared to gamble a bit on the stock market. Discretionary income is needed here so you do not totally risk your 401k or other investment portfolio items. While most financial advisors say to diversify to spread the risk, you must concentrate your money on a few stocks to grab a larger pay-off. This is risky, but can earn big bucks quickly if the market is in your favor.

Don't stick with name brands on the stock market. If you want to know how to get rich fast, look to lesser-known companies that have revenues that are continually growing, at least 15-20% per year. Look for trends in emerging markets. While some stocks may not be hot right now but the market forecasts potential growth, invest and watch your money grow. Environmentally friendly companies are big business these days whereas they weren't just ten years ago.

The Slow Route to Riches

Look into the things you spend money on in your everyday life and find ways to cut back. This is the slow way on how to get rich. There is always a cheaper alternative for such things as automobile insurance, cell phone rates, cable, food and even electricity.

Trim your insurance by raising your deductible or changing parameters in the policy. And do you really need that fancy Blackberry with Internet access and emailing capability? Save on electricity by choosing a balanced billing method. Clip coupons and look for sales with double coupon rates in grocery stores to save money. Do you really need all of those cable movie channels when you are only home long enough one-day a week to take advantage of all the selections?

If you want to know how to get rich, track all of your expenses and see where you money goes each month. You would be amazed that by employing some of the tips above, you could save hundreds of dollars each month. And you know what you can do with that saved money? Put it in a savings account earning at least 3% interest with an online FDIC-backed bank. Let that money grow and keep adding to it.

Keep in mind that some of the ideas on how to get rich should not be implemented if they could potentially undermine facets of your life. For example, if you had to purchase your own health insurance, do not skimp on such things as short or long-term disability. Life is a crap shoot and if paying a few extra bucks a month is the difference between supporting your family five years down the road when you are injured and cannot work versus banking a few extra dollars now, go for the path that takes care of your family needs first.

Make Sure Business is Booming by Finding New Business Opportunities

Copyright: Earl Williams
The NetMarketer

Starting your own business with one great idea is one thing. Keeping that business fresh and profitable for the long haul is quite another. Most business owners find that while their initial business plan is good enough to get them up and running, they need to diversify and come up with new approaches and new angles to really keep building the business. Of course, coming up with new business opportunities is often easier said than done if it were that easy, everyone would be in business for himself or herself! That doesn't mean it can't be done, however. There are a few different ways you can approach developing new business opportunities. Read on.

Your first approach to finding new business opportunities is looking to expand what you already have in a new way. In other words, look for an untapped revenue stream that might already be in your business or that could be added to your business with a minimum of effort and go from there. For instance, if you own a coffee shop and you sell coffee and Danishes, maybe you could add sandwiches or specialty teas to your menu that would attract new customers without requiring a great deal of new research or investment from you. Take a good look at your business and see if there are any holes in the services you are offering that you can fill without stretching yourself too thin. You may find that you can increase your income without making too many drastic changes.

The second approach is similar to the first, but it involves going directly to new customers instead of hatching new services to attract them. Do all of your potential customers know that you're out there? Could you be doing business with people that simply don't know you're around? For instance, if you have a catering business, have you reached out to all of the companies in the area to see if they need a lunch caterer? There may be people right under your nose with great new business opportunities you just haven't met yet. Cast your net a little wider, and you may find new opportunities are on your doorstep.

The third approach to finding new business opportunities is one that requires a major change and it definitely isn't for everyone. Although some people feel like their one business is there baby, other people are business junkies. If you fall into the later category, then you can find new business opportunities by looking outside of the business you have now and seeing what the hottest new business ideas are. If you religiously read the business papers and surf the net, then you will know which businesses are being buzzed about. By following these leads, you can really diversify by having a finger in lots of different pies.

Of course, when looking for new business opportunities, remember to be lead by your goals and abilities and not what sounds good for the moment. Your business needs to be both successful and enjoyable, so choose accordingly.
